THE INSIDE STORY

Zurich is a microcosm of Switzerland: the national identity of quality, discretion and precision lays itself across medieval streets that open onto a pristine lake backdropped by the cascading Alps. As one of the birthplaces of the Reformation, when some Christians rejected spiritually and physically the decadence of Catholicism, the streetscape is on the less decorative side among major European cities; and its renown as the financial centre of Switzerland, and maybe the world, might lead the casual visitor to assume that it's simply a dull banker bunker.

But while lunchtime at Paradeplatz—the central square where the equivalents of New York's Wall Street, Times Square and Fifth Avenue meet—is flooded by a sea of blue suits, underneath the veneer of gold bars, watches and melted cheese is a bustling system of creative collaboration that spans and interconnects the small city centre.

Zurich's central setting—Paris and Milan are easy couple-of-hour trips away and even Berlin and Vienna feel close, with their direct connections—means inhabitants from across Europe are constantly comingling here. Many creatives split their time between one of these larger cities and the Swiss metropolis, bringing a constant influx of new people and ideas.

Here's how to enjoy the city like a very cool local.

Kunsthalle Zurich

Kunsthalle Zurich exhibits contemporary art across two floors of a renovated former brewery. Last year, it welcomed its new director, Fanny Hauser, a young Viennese curator with regional experience, who also formerly worked at the Swiss Gebert Foundation for Culture. This year, the exhibition space celebrates its 40th anniversary; with Hauser in place, we look forward to an unexpected multigenerational and international programme.
